Escape From Playtime Announced: Poppy Playtime Co-Op Survival Horror
Mob Entertainment announced 'Escape from Playtime' during the Future Games Show at gamescom 2026 broadcast on August 27, 2026. The game is a survival horror title with up to 4-player co-op, set in the world of 'Poppy Playtime.' It supports single-player and online co-op. Players control the Smiling Critters, first introduced in 'Poppy Playtime' Chapter 3, as they crouch, jump, and climb to escape from failed experiments created by Playtime Co. They explore locations such as classrooms, warehouses, and laboratories, following a mysterious voice to collect parts and resources and bring them back to a safe place. The facility changes with each playthrough via auto-generated layouts, and the game supports proximity voice chat. The initial early access release will include 8 characters, one area, and multiple enemies, with plans to add new areas and features based on feedback. The supported platform is PC (Steam), with Japanese language support planned. A trailer and Steam store page were released alongside the announcement.
